Highest end of day price: 2.1181232996547 CNY (ยฃ0.29 USD) on 2024-05-20
Lowest end of day price: 0.18027470264601 CNY (ยฃ0.02643 USD) on 2008-10-29
Year | Performance |
---|---|
2025 | 24.31% |
2024 | 18.93% |
2023 | 8.78% |
2022 | 3.94% |
2021 | 0.40% |
2020 | 102.95% |
2019 | 46.02% |
2018 | -26.65% |
2017 | 32.71% |
2016 | 12.97% |
2015 | -4.91% |
2014 | 50.80% |
2013 | -39.12% |
2012 | -1.73% |
2011 | -28.09% |
2010 | -8.16% |
2009 | 75.45% |
2008 | -52.41% |